Why Python is the Best Language for Beginners?
If you have never written a line of code, learning Python gives you a key advantage: you can understand what you are writing. Many other languages have complex syntax, strict rules, and technical jargon. Python keeps things simple.
For Example:
#A simple Python program to filter even numbers from a list
numbers = [3, 8, 12, 5, 7, 20]
#Using a list comprehension to filter even numbers
even_numbers = [num for num in numbers if num % 2 == 0]
print("Original list:", numbers)
print("Even numbers:", even_numbers)
This tiny snippet shows how quickly you can write something useful and actually understand every part of it. For a new learner, these small wins matter; they create momentum. Python helps you stay curious rather than frustrated.
What Makes Python Easy to Learn?
Python specifically lowers cognitive load for beginners. Its strengths include:
- A Natural, English-like Syntax: Python code looks like instructions written in plain language.
- Minimal Technical Barriers: You do not need prior knowledge of math, engineering, or programming.
- Easy-to-Read Code: You spend more time understanding logic, not memorizing rules.
- Strong Beginner Ecosystem: Millions of learners, guides, tutorials, and communities support beginners.
- Quick Setup & Simple Tools: Python runs on any device with minimal installation steps.
Its simplicity lets you focus on understanding why something works rather than struggling with the language.
How Learning Python Applies to Real-World Use Cases?
When someone new to coding asks, “Where is Python used?”, the honest answer is: almost everywhere. Here is how different professionals use it:
- Students: Build small programs and academic projects
- Office Professionals: Automate Excel tasks, emails, and reports
- Analysts: Clean and transform data
- Researchers: Process datasets and run simulations
- Creators: Make small apps, bots, and scripts
- Tech Teams: Work on websites, AI models, and backend systems
Python’s versatility makes learning Python practical, not abstract. Its rich ecosystem of libraries supports almost any application:
- Pandas & NumPy: Data professionals widely use Pandas and NumPy for data cleaning, analysis, and numerical computation.
- TensorFlow and PyTorch: Essential tools in machine learning and deep learning, helping developers build models for prediction, classification, and AI applications.
- Django and Flask: Support web development, enabling the creation of dynamic websites, APIs, and backend systems with minimal complexity.
These libraries allow beginners to progress from simple scripts to more sophisticated real-world projects as their skills deepen.

Quick Comparison: Python vs. Other Beginner Languages
| Language | Ease of Learning | Readability | Beginner Support | Use Cases |
| Python | Very Easy | Very High | Excellent | Web, AI, Automation, Data, DevOps scripting |
| Java | Moderate | Medium | High | Enterprise apps, Android |
| C++ | Hard | Low | Low | System programming, gaming |
| JavaScript | Moderate | Medium | Excellent | Web development, Backend, Mobile & Desktop apps |
| Ruby | Easy | High | Good | Web development |
